Bed bugs do not have a larval stage; instead, they hatch from eggs directly into nymphs. After about 6 to 10 days, the eggs hatch into nymphs, which then go through five molts before reaching adulthood. The entire process from egg to adult can take several weeks to a few months, depending on environmental conditions like temperature and availability of food.
